Versatile, maneuverable and precise: a control-focused evolution in the Bullpadel range.

The Bullpadel Flow 2027 padel racket from BULLPADEL / AGUIRRE favors ease of use and precision over raw power. It follows modern cues (slightly teardrop shape, mid-balance) to deliver a smooth-playing racket suited to players seeking consistency and comfort. After several sessions on different courts, here is my full analysis.

✅ Strengths
Control and tolerance: With a rather centered balance and a comfortably sized hitting surface, the Flow 2027 prioritizes precision from the baseline and control in rallies. Ideal for building points and tactical players.

Remarkable maneuverability: Its lightweight construction and slim profile make it very maneuverable, easing changes of pace, volleys and quick defenses.

Comfortable feel: The core, tuned for damping (comfort-oriented composition typical of the "Flow" models), limits vibrations and provides a good feel on ball contact, useful for chaining shots without tension.

Surface suited to spin: The face finish enhances grip for slices and topspin without requiring violent swings, helping to vary play.

Reasonable attacking versatility: While not focused on pure power, it still allows clean finishes thanks to controlled ball output and good energy transfer on well-placed shots.

❌ Points to watch
Not for maximum power seekers: Players after explosive smashes or very aggressive ball launches will find the Flow 2027 limited compared to full-power models.

Less suited to very heavy players: Fans of high-weight, head-heavy rackets won’t get the same momentum advantage; the racket favors maneuverability over mass-driven power.

Target player profile: It’s mainly aimed at intermediate to advanced players seeking control and comfort. Pure beginners or competitors focused on brute force should consider other options.

Introduction


Discover the Bullpadel Flow 2027 padel racket, designed by BULLPADEL / AGUIRRE and inspired by Alejandra Salazar's play. This premium pala targets advanced female players seeking the perfect balance of lightness, maneuverability and controlled power, to chain volleys, bandejas and clean phases with fluidity and precision.



Materials


The Flow 2027 combines an outer Fibrx surface with a MULTIEVA core, offering an optimal compromise between stiffness and energy absorption. The 3D Grain rough finish enhances spin and control during offensive play, while the integration of FLOWCORE and VIBRADRIVE elements contributes to structural stability and vibration reduction for a more confident and comfortable feel.



Weight


The racket is designed to remain light and maneuverable, specifically suited to players who want to reduce forearm fatigue while retaining a reserve of power. Its standard 38 mm profile contributes to this balance, with a calibrated weight that favors responsiveness and arm speed on court.



Shape


The Flow 2027 adopts a diamond shape that promotes a higher sweet spot and a more offensive ball projection. This geometry allows for greater power on smashes and net attacks while maintaining sufficient maneuverability for quick placements and defenses.



Playing Style


Designed for versatile play with a focus on controlled power, the Flow targets advanced female players who alternate between attacking phases and volley play. It facilitates aggressive strikes from the baseline as well as rapid transitions to the net, while offering a medium feel that aids trajectory and spin control.



Technologies


The main technologies integrated into the Flow 2027 include MULTIEVA for a multi-density core optimizing power and comfort, VIBRADRIVE to improve energy transmission and reduce vibrations, FLOWCORE for structural rigidity, and 3D GRAIN to maximize surface grip and spin. The combination of these solutions delivers strong overall performance and a clean touch in all situations.



Design


The Flow 2027's design reflects elegance and modernity, with a refined aesthetic tied to Alejandra Salazar's line. The finishes highlight the 3D texture and technical elements (discreet logo and signatures), offering a racket that is as visually attractive as it is high-performing on court.
